Hey Chief Delphi,
We are the Charging Champions, a six-member FTC team from SoCal. We had a question regarding set up of the rolling goals. Before the match starts, how does the ref set up the rolling goals? Are they parallel to the walls and how far are they away from the wall?
Thanks,
Charging Champions
According to the game manual: "Each Rolling Goal is centered in a tile, with the 90cm Rolling Goal in the corner, the 60cm Rolling Goal one tile toward the Alliance’s Ramp/Platform, and the 30cm Rolling Goal one tile from the corner toward the opposing Alliance Parking Zone."
From what I saw, that's exactly how they were set - centered in a tile. They were not set using a measuring device, just centered in a tile.

I believe it was somewhere in the official forum that the orientation of the base pentagon is random - refs do not align them parallel to the wall.
MattRain
17-03-2015, 11:39
Yep, center of the tile, the pentagon base rotation is random.
